Overflow urinary incontinence caused by an obstruction or a tightened urethra can be treated with surgery to eliminate the blockage. Anxiety incontinence in guys can be treated with the male sling-- a procedure in which mesh is placed under the urethra, training and supporting the urethra and sphincter muscles. Consuming insufficient liquid can trigger body waste items to accumulate in pee. The waste items can create pee to be dark yellow with a strong smell. The build-up can irritate the bladder and boost the demand to go. Usually, way of life modifications and/or other clinical therapies are recommended to treat nocturia.
